Off the top of my head:
1) Better animal/enemy AI and more activity at space stations, trading posts, etc would make the game feel more 'alive'.
2) More variety in buildings, animal models, etc.
3) Something to do with all this money I'm accruing now that I've maxed my multi-tool, suit and ship.
4) Being able to search for systems by name on the galactic map. An arrow pointing to the 'centre' may also be useful for the purpose or orientation when rotating the map.
5) A less cumbersome UI.
6) More thought given to the achievements: For example, why did I get the top achievement for language when I'd learned less than half of my first language?
I could probably come up with a lot more, but I don't want to turn this into a wall of text. I do like the game overall, though. :)

Yup, v2.0 includes hover now, but read the patch notes as there is a slight bug in it where if you look down while hovering you can sustain a little damage to your ship. Its minor damage, and be be avoided by keeping hold of the throttle down key while you look around.
